What are the most common Toyota repairs needed by drivers in the Hartford, WV area?

Given the hilly terrain and seasonal weather, Hartford-area Toyotas frequently need brake service, suspension component replacement (like struts and control arms), and battery checks, especially before winter. Models like the Camry and RAV4 also commonly require routine maintenance for oil changes and tire rotations due to local driving conditions.

How can I find a reputable and trustworthy Toyota repair shop near Hartford?

Look for shops with ASE-certified technicians, positive online reviews from local customers, and those that explicitly mention experience with Toyota vehicles. In the Hartford area, it's also beneficial to ask for recommendations from neighbors or at local community centers, as word-of-mouth is strong for reliable service.

Are repair costs for Toyotas higher in Hartford compared to larger cities?

Labor rates in Hartford are often more competitive than in major metropolitan areas, which can lead to lower overall repair bills. However, parts costs are generally consistent, so getting a detailed written estimate that breaks down parts and labor from your local shop is the best way to understand pricing.

When should I seek service for my Toyota's check engine light around Hartford?

You should seek diagnostic service promptly, as the light could indicate issues exacerbated by local conditions, such as oxygen sensor problems from frequent short trips or emissions system issues. Many Hartford-area shops offer free code reading to help determine the urgency before you commit to repairs.

What local factors in Hartford should I consider for my Toyota's maintenance schedule?

The humid summers and cold, snowy winters in the Ohio River Valley mean you should pay extra attention to your cooling system, battery health, and tire condition. Using all-weather or seasonal tires and ensuring undercarriage washes to combat road salt corrosion are key local considerations for your Toyota's longevity.
